Burnt Creek LLC Access
A right-of-way approximately 4,900 feet in length and 24 feet in width encompassing 2.70 acres, more or less, in Secs. 20 & 29, T. 37 N., R. 5 E., NMPM, Rio Grande County, Colorado, for the purpose of accessing private property.
Project Summary
Location Summary:
Private inholding is located approximately one mile north of Jasper, CO. Burnt Creek runs through the middle of the property.
